The process was pretty straight forward. It was not much different than the other reviews for work at home positions indicated. Mine went as follows:
10/15: Applied online.
10/24: Got email asking me to schedule my phone interview.
10/30: Phone interview with a woman who was very robotic. She had no personality and kept asking me the same question over and over again even after I answered it. It was very frustrating. I just knew I was not going to move forward after that bad experience.
11/2: Received email to complete background check info online.
11/6: Scheduled for 2nd interview.
11/9: 2nd interview via WebEx with a recruiter. I was told I would hear something within 7-10 days.
11/19: Offer received. Start date at the end of Jan. 2019. (I was told during my 1st interview that there would be sooooo many schedules available, but when I was given the offer, there were only 3 offered. None of them were great. That is why I declined the offer.)

I’m just going to save you some time. If you have ANYTHING planned in the next 5 months after you apply, don’t bother. It’s going to take about a month just to get through part of the interview process. Once you put in all that time and effort, they’re going to turn you down if you have prior engagements. At all. Even a day. I can’t believe they actually expect candidates to have nothing planned for nearly half a year. So, again, if you have a trip you’ve paid for, or anything planned, don’t waste your time. You’re disposable to them, and they will NOT accommodate you.
